[6.0] "Thus far she is brand new to the business & has only worked on the WWELFG training show. So take that into consideration when looking at this review. From the outset of WWELFG, she had the best look of the bunch. She is more natural in the ring than the other trainees, but during her time, it felt like she hit a wall & wasn't progressing further. I'm not sure she ever found her groove as far as falling into a character she could really get behind. One week she would be a chipper babyface, then next she'd try being a mean heel, then during the nickname class she chose "detonator" & tried to work with that, which didn't feel like a fit either. By the end, she was working more as a heavenly babyface persona, which seemed like the best fit that I had seen from her. I think if she finds her place within the wrestling landscape, she can really get over."
